Filter Your Search

Off-Campus Apartments for Rent in South Shore

243 Rentals Available

    • Photo - 35 Newport St

    35 Newport St

    35 Newport St, Boston, MA 02125

    3 Beds$3,950

    7.8 miles to Berklee Campus